Colorado Code § 31-23-302

Districts

For any of the purposes enumerated in section 31-23-301, the
governing body may divide the municipality into districts of such number, shape, and area as
may be deemed best suited to carry out the purposes of this part 3, and within such districts it
may regulate and restrict the erection, construction, reconstruction, alteration, repair, or use of
buildings, structures, or land. All such regulations shall be uniform for each class or kind of
buildings throughout each district, but the regulations in one district may differ from those in
other districts.
